UC Davis Pantry: Free Food & Emergency Supplies for Students & Staff

UC Davis Pantry provides essential food assistance to students, staff, and faculty across campus. This resource helps people manage financial stress, unexpected expenses, and food insecurity linked to rising living costs.

Whether you are navigating a tight budget or supporting household needs, the pantry offers practical support that complements campus financial and academic services. The following sections outline eligibility, offerings, locations, and policies that make this resource integral to campus community well-being.

Eligibility and Campus Community Access

UC Davis Pantry prioritizes current students, staff, and faculty members. Visitors verify identity using a UC ID card or staff badge, which helps maintain fair access during high-demand periods. This focus supports retention and academic success by reducing basic needs uncertainty.

Community members experiencing temporary hardships are encouraged to check for special short-term support windows. Availability may expand during registration cycles and midterms, aligning with campus calendars to meet increased need.

Pantry Location, Hours, and Safety Guidelines

The pantry is located in a central campus building to maximize convenience and privacy. Standard hours provide flexibility for evening and weekend visitors, though holiday schedules may vary. Clear signage and wayfinding help first-time visitors navigate the site efficiently.

Health and safety standards include temperature checks for perishable items and organized storage to prevent spoilage. Hand sanitizer stations and designated queuing areas support a respectful environment for all guests.

Donations, Inventory Management, and Partnerships

Inventory relies on campus donations, local retailers, and grant-funded purchases. Volunteers coordinate sorting and distribution, ensuring that items match dietary preferences and accessibility needs. Regular partnerships with campus groups strengthen consistent supply.

Tracking systems monitor stock levels to avoid shortages of high-demand staples. Seasonal campaigns during fall and spring encourage class-specific involvement, turning giving into a shared campus tradition.

Policy, Confidentiality, and Long-Term Support

Pantry operations follow UC Davis guidelines on privacy and nondiscrimination. Personal information stays confidential, and staff are trained to refer guests to additional services when needed. This approach builds trust and encourages repeat use.

Long-term planning includes expanding hours and improving digital communication. Future goals involve extending service to summer sessions and integrating with housing support for off-campus students.

FAQ

Reader questions

How do I prove my eligibility to use the UC Davis Pantry?

Present a valid UC Davis ID card or staff/ faculty badge for verification at check-in.

What types of items can I expect to find at the pantry?

Expect nonperishable staples like canned foods, pasta, rice, snacks, and basic hygiene products, with variety based on donations.

Do I need an appointment, or can I visit as a walk-in guest?

Both options are usually available; check the current schedule online as appointment slots can fill quickly during peak times.

Is there a limit on how often I can visit the UC Davis Pantry?

Guidelines vary by season, but staff will discuss visit frequency and connect you with additional resources if ongoing support is needed.
